My friend’s comments:
One of my favourite harnesses is the “Oriental Rope Dress” which I learned to tie from a Canadian submariner. You start with fifty feet of 5/8″ rope [scotch braid nylon is his favorite] – a kind that feels nice next to your skin, and you end up with this beautiful harness.
Good nylon rope doesn’t chafe or burn, and feels silky.
